Question:
Invoice ID: 110765806 Installed your hitch on a 2020 Nissan Rogue. How do I remove the panels in the trunk area to access the wiring without breaking various clips? Ive not yet been able to find a video showing how to do that,
asked by: Bj E
Expert Reply:
I have attached below an installation video of the T-One Vehicle Wiring Harness part # 118480 which is a fit for a 2020 Nissan Rogue. The video is on an earlier model but the install process will be the same. The majority of the panels just pull straight out. The manufacturers install instructions are also attached below as well.
